Can regular lawn care from Jon's Lawns help prevent issues like sprinkler leaks in Bellingham?

Absolutely. While we don't perform major sprinkler repairs, our consistent lawn care includes monitoring the health of your grass. During mowing and maintenance, our trained technicians often spot early signs of sprinkler issues, like overly dry or soggy patches, which can indicate leaks or misaligned heads. We'll alert you to these potential problems early, helping you address small leaks before they become costly water-wasters or damage your lawn—a common concern for Bellingham homeowners.

How does your lawn care service help stabilize rock gardens that are shifting?

Proper lawn care around rock gardens is key to their stability. We carefully edge and trim around these features to prevent grass and weed roots from undermining the rocks. Furthermore, we manage soil health and drainage in the surrounding lawn area. Poor drainage can lead to soil erosion or frost heave, common in Bellingham, which causes shifting. By ensuring your adjacent lawn is healthy and well-maintained, we help create a stable environment that supports your rock garden's integrity.

What specific lawn care practices do you use for Bellingham's climate to protect my landscaping investment?

We tailor our practices to Bellingham's unique Pacific Northwest climate. This includes adjusting mowing heights seasonally to promote root depth for drought resistance, managing thatch to prevent mold and moss (common in our damp seasons), and advising on aeration schedules to combat soil compaction from rain. These proactive, climate-specific steps strengthen your entire landscape, making it more resilient against local stressors that can lead to bigger issues like erosion or irrigation problems, ultimately protecting your investment.
